Procedimiento

Methanesulfonyl chloride (0.13 mL, 1.7 mmol) was added dropwise to a mixture of 1-(4-aminomethylbenzyl)-2-ethoxymethyl-7-(pyridin-3-yl)-1H-imidazo[4,5-c]quinolin-4-amine (0.520 g, 1.2 mmol) in dichloromethane (10 mL). The reaction was stirred for 16 hours and then saturated aqueous sodium carbonate was added. The layers were separated and the aqueous fraction was extracted with 95:5 chloroform/methanol. The organic fractions were combined and washed sequentially with water and saturated aqueous sodium chloride, dried over sodium sulfate, filtered, and concentrated under reduced pressure. The resulting solid was purified by flash column chromatography with a gradient of CMA (2%–10%) in chloroform as the eluent. A final recrystallization from 2-propanol provided 0.240 g of N-{4-[4-amino-2-ethoxymethyl-7-(pyridin-3-yl)-1H-imidazo[4,5-c]quinolin-1-ylmethyl]benzyl}methanesulfonamide as white granular crystals, mp 228.0–229.0° C.
